We currently use LDAP authentication on all our apache servers to authenticate our staff against our AD. However we are looking at a mass move to Google Apps and need to allow the single sign on ability still.

 

We can keep the AD in place, and then have Google suck the AD account details from that ("authenticate against AD" would be the wrong term). We could also then use AD for the apache stuff still.

 

However there is also an idea to move away from AD completely as we are increasingly non-AD specific (macs, linux etc). Does anyone know if there is a module already in use that would allow apache to authenticate using Google App details?
